KNU Disputes Report Saying it Controls a Third of Thai Border Areas

by Admin | Jul 23, 2025 | Daily News, Resistance

Source: Burma News International | By Karen Information Center

The Karen National Union (KNU) has disputed a report saying the group controls about one third of the border area with Thailand and claims that it instead controls 90 per cent of the border area.
